Notes | IMPORTANT: The following describes the Data Pattern setup: Addresses [$400 - $13FF] are 4K D-Flash. Addresses [$4000 - $7FFF] are 16K P-Flash PPAGE 0Dh. Addresses [$C000 - $FFFF] are 16K P-Flash PPAGE 0Fh. Addresses [$A8000 - $ABFFF] are 16K P-Flash PPAGE 0Ah. Addresses [$B8000 - $BBFFF] are 16K P-Flash PPAGE 0Bh. Addresses [$C8000 - $CBFFF] are 16K P-Flash PPAGE 0Ch. Addresses [$E8000 - $EBFFF] are 16K P-Flash PPAGE 0Eh. There are two security bits in the PPAGE 0Fh. These bits (SEC01 SEC00) are Bit1 and Bit0 of address $FF0F in the Data Pattern. |
